Employees are responsible for the proper care of all District facilities, equipment, and property in their custody or control.
Control of District property shall be through, but not limited to, an accurate fixed inventory system of all District furniture and equipment that exceeds one thousand dollars ($1,000) in value.
The Superintendent may establish procedures for transferring surplus or other materials and equipment.
Preventive Maintenance
The Superintendent shall establish a preventive-maintenance program that will extend the useful life for District equipment.
The Superintendent is authorized to use the services of specialists for such maintenance, and provision(s) shall be made in the annual budget for such services.
